Yeah, the thing is most of these names are not ski runs per se, they are either avalanche starting zones or paths and in order to be able to remember which is which you need memorable (to you) names. Given enough time ski areas get a name for every feature. BB has numerous names for the same shit depending on what era you are in.
For Nashville Basin, I believe that is a name that appears on some USGS 7.5 scale maps, then around 1990 a patroller claimed she "saw Elvis" while poaching on the job over there before there was a Moonlight Basin.
And if you stand at the right spot and squint your eyes the chutes from Firehole looking left spell Elvis.I have been in this State for 30 years and I am willing to admit that I am part of the problem.
